Vitamin A treatment trial for Covid loss of smell

In a 12-week trial of the University of East Anglia, only some of the volunteer patients will get the treatment but all will be asked to smell powerful odors such as rotten roses and eggs. China's Zijin Mining - Acquiring Neo Lithium in $737 mln deal

China’s Zijin Mining – Acquiring Neo Lithium in $737 mln deal

Canada’s Neo Lithium Corp will be bought by China’s Zijin Mining Group Co Ltd for a high price of C$918.7 million ($737.14 million), according to news on Friday.
